The football community is mourning the sudden passing of inaugural Adelaide premiership player Heather Anderson.

The quietly spoken defender was famed for not only her work ethic but the pink helmet she wore to help her vision-impaired mother spot her on the field. But her professional football career ended at age 23 in late 2017, when she reluctantly retired from the top level after a second serious shoulder dislocation in the 2017 AFLW grand final.
